Kapusta is a Polish cabbage dish baked with onions, mushrooms, and sauerkraut. This grandmother's recipe can be served as a side or a vegetarian main dish.

Recipe Instructions
Step 1
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
Step 2
Place cabbage in a medium saucepan; add water to cover. Bring to a boil over high heat; cook until tender, about 10 minutes. Drain.
Step 3
While the cabbage is cooking, melt 4 tablespoons butter in a large skillet over medium heat. Add onions and mushrooms; sauté until tender, 5 to 7 minutes. Remove from the heat.
Step 4
Combine drained cabbage, onion-mushroom mixture, sauerkraut, sugar, thyme, salt, and pepper in a 9x13-inch baking dish; mix until well combined. Cut remaining 2 tablespoons butter into small pieces and arrange over top. Cover with aluminum foil.
Step 5
Bake in the preheated oven for 1 hour, stirring every 20 minutes.
